Understanding Scotia Online for Business Jamaica
Before we jump into the login specifics, let's take a quick look at what Scotia Online for Business Jamaica actually is. Essentially, it's Scotiabank's online banking platform specifically designed for business owners and entrepreneurs in Jamaica. Think of it as your digital financial command center, allowing you to manage your accounts, make transactions, and stay on top of your finances – all from the comfort of your office, home, or even on the go via your mobile device. With Scotia Online for Business Jamaica, you can access a range of services, including:
- Account Balance Inquiries: Keep track of your balances across all your business accounts.
- Transaction History: View and download your transaction history for detailed record-keeping.
- Fund Transfers: Easily transfer funds between your Scotiabank accounts or to other local and international banks.
- Bill Payments: Pay your business bills online, saving you time and hassle.
- Foreign Exchange: Access foreign exchange services to manage your international transactions.
- Reporting: Generate reports to gain insights into your financial performance.

The Step-by-Step Scotia Online for Business Jamaica Login Process
Alright, now for the main event: the Scotia Online for Business Jamaica login process! Here's a straightforward, easy-to-follow guide:
- Access the Scotiabank Website: Open your web browser (Chrome, Firefox, Safari, etc.) and go to the official Scotiabank Jamaica website. Make sure you're on the legitimate website to avoid any phishing attempts. Always double-check the URL to ensure it starts with "https://" and has the correct domain name.
- Navigate to the Business Banking Section: Look for the "Business" or "Business Banking" option on the website's main menu. This might be located at the top or in a prominent section of the homepage.
- Locate the Login Button: Within the Business Banking section, you'll find a "Login" button or a similar call-to-action. Click on this button to proceed.
- Enter Your User ID: You'll be prompted to enter your User ID. This ID is typically provided to you when you enroll in Scotia Online for Business. It's usually a combination of letters and numbers. Ensure you enter this information accurately, paying close attention to capitalization and special characters.
- Enter Your Password: After entering your User ID, you'll be prompted to enter your password. This is the password you created during the enrollment process. It should be a strong, secure password that's unique to your Scotiabank account. Consider using a combination of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Be sure to keep this password confidential and do not share it with anyone.
- Security Verification (If Applicable): Depending on your security settings, you might be asked to complete a security verification step. This could involve entering a one-time security code sent to your mobile phone or answering a security question. This is an added layer of protection to safeguard your account.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ete this step.
- Access Your Account: Once you've entered your User ID, password, and completed any security verification steps, click the "Login" button (or whatever the button is labeled). If all the information is correct, you'll be logged into your Scotia Online for Business Jamaica account, where you can start managing your finances.

Troubleshooting Common Scotia Online for Business Jamaica Login Issues
Sometimes, things don't go as planned. Let's look at some common login issues and how to resolve them:
- Incorrect User ID or Password: The most common issue. Double-check that you're entering the correct User ID and password. Remember that passwords are case-sensitive. If you've forgotten your password, use the "Forgot Password" link to initiate a password reset.
- Locked Account: If you enter the wrong password multiple times, your account may be locked for security reasons. Contact Scotiabank customer service to unlock your account.
- Technical Issues: Occasionally, there might be technical issues on Scotiabank's end. If you're experiencing problems, try clearing your browser's cache and cookies or using a different browser. If the issue persists, contact Scotiabank's customer support.
- Browser Compatibility: Make sure you're using a compatible web browser. Older browsers may not support the latest security features and can cause login issues.
- Internet Connection: Ensure you have a stable internet connection. A weak or unstable connection can interrupt the login process.
- Security Software Interference: Some security software or browser extensions might interfere with the login process. Try temporarily disabling these and attempting to log in again.

Security Best Practices for Scotia Online for Business
Protecting your financial information is critical. Here are some key security tips:
- Use Strong Passwords: Create a strong, unique password for your Scotia Online for Business account. Change your password regularly and avoid using easily guessable information like your birthday or pet's name.
- En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): 2FA adds an extra layer of security to your account. This requires a second method of verification (like a code sent to your phone) when you log in.
- Be Wary of Phishing: Be cautious of suspicious emails or messages asking for your login credentials. Never click on links or provide personal information unless you're sure the source is legitimate. Always go directly to the Scotiabank website to log in.
- Keep Your Software Updated: Ensure your computer's operating system, web browser, and antivirus software are up to date. This helps protect against malware and security vulnerabilities.
- Use a Secure Network: Avoid using public Wi-Fi networks when accessing your online banking account. These networks can be vulnerable to hacking. Use a secure, private network instead.
- Monitor Your Accounts Regularly: Review your account activity frequently to catch any unauthorized transactions or suspicious activity. Report any suspicious activity to Scotiabank immediately.
- Educate Your Employees: If you have employees with access to your online banking account, train them on security best practices and the importance of protecting sensitive information.
